Description

A flaw was found in sg3_utils. The sg_inq command, when invoked with the --export option, outputs device identification data without sanitizing control characters in SCSI name string fields. A newline character embedded in a device-supplied name string can inject arbitrary properties into the udev device database. This could allow an attacker who can present a crafted SCSI device to execute arbitrary commands as root when the device is disconnected.

Metrics

CVSS 3.1
7.6/10

CVSS:3.1/AV:P/AC:L/PR:N/UI:N/S:C/C:H/I:H/A:H

Weakness Enumeration

Affected Software

Source: CNA advisory (CVE.org). NVD analysis pending.

VendorProductVersions
Red HatRed Hat Enterprise Linux 10All versions
Red HatRed Hat Enterprise Linux 7All versions
Red HatRed Hat Enterprise Linux 8All versions
Red HatRed Hat Enterprise Linux 9All versions
Red HatRed Hat OpenShift Container Platform 4All versions
